Clients sometimes assume that because you are a freelancer, you can handle anything related to your general field. A writer might be asked to edit videos, or a designer might be asked to write marketing copy, which are completely different skills. Saying no feels risky because you do not want to lose the client, but saying yes when you are not qualified can lead to poor results and damage your reputation. Have you ever been put in this position, and how did you handle it without losing the client or compromising your standards?
